OpenTelemetry-native observability platform built for high-cardinality, high-dimensionality debugging of distributed systems — storing traces, logs, and metrics in a unified data layer with sub-second query performance and AI-assisted investigations.

Key Features

  1. Unified storage for traces, logs, and metrics with seamless transformation between signals
  2. Sub-10 second queries across high-cardinality data (unlimited fields at no extra cost)
  3. BubbleUp for automatic root cause analysis in under three minutes
  4. SLOs with debuggable burn alerts
  5. Service maps and distributed tracing
  6. Anomaly detection
  7. AI-powered Canvas copilot for guided investigations
  8. MCP server integration for Claude Code, Cursor, and other AI agents
  9. Honeycomb Agent Skills for automated onboarding, migration, and instrumentation
  10. Automated Investigations that autonomously detect, diagnose, and recommend fixes
  11. Pipeline Intelligence for AI-driven telemetry pipeline configuration
  12. OpenTelemetry-native with no vendor lock-in

Background

  1. Co-founded in 2016 by Charity Majors (CTO) and Christine Yen (CEO) in San Francisco.
  2. Credited with defining and popularizing the modern concept of "observability" for software engineering.
  3. Raised ~$150M total, including a $50M Series D led by Headline in 2023, with backing from Scale Venture Partners, Insight Partners, and others.
  4. Honeycomb Metrics reached general availability in March 2026, completing the unified telemetry story.
